How Our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Process Works
When water damage strikes your restaurant, every minute counts. That’s why we’ve developed a proven process to get the job done quickly and effectively. We’ll work closely with you to assess the damage, develop a plan, and execute a thorough restoration. Our team will use specialized equipment to extract water, dry out the area, and repair any damaged materials. We’ll also work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
Assessment and Planning
Our team will conduct a thorough assessment of the damage to find out the extent of the problem. We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to get your restaurant back up and running. This includes identifying the source of the water damage, assessing the affected area, and determining the necessary repairs.
Water Extraction and Removal
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age. We’ll also use industrial-grade drying equipment to speed up the drying process.
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area, including industrial-grade drying equipment and dehumidifiers. This will help pr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.
Repair and Reconstruction
Once the area is dry, our team will work with you to repair or replace any damaged materials, including flooring, walls, and ceilings. We’ll also ensure that all electrical and plumbing systems are functioning properly.
Cleaning and Disinfection
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ll also ensure that all surfaces are free of any remaining water or debris.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ak with minimal damage |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small leaks with minimal damage. |
| Large area of standing water | No | Yes | Large areas of standing water need spec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ively extract. |
| Visible signs of mold or mildew | No | Yes | Visible signs of mold or mildew need professional cleaning and disinfection to prevent further growth and health risks. |
| Electrical or plumbing issues | No | Yes | Electrical or plumbing issues can be hazardous and need professional expertise to safely repair. |
| High humidity or moisture levels | No | Yes | High humidity or moisture levels can show water damage or poor ventilation and need professional expertise to safely and effectively address. |
| Structural damage to walls or ceiling | No | Yes | Structural damage to walls or ceiling needs professional expertise to safely and effectively repair. |

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ost In Northumberland, NY
The cost of water damage restoration in Northumberland, NY can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the work.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500-$1,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water present |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000-$5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ning solution used |
| Assessment and Planning | $100-$500 | Complexity of damage, size of affected area |
| Emergency Services (after hours) | $200-$1,000 | Time of day, urgency of situation |
